v1.2.2 — "Readable Depths"

The dream screen whispered in italics the player couldn't hear. Text scale now defaults to 150%, title and dream overlays stay legible at that size no matter what you pick in settings, and the subtext finally has enough contrast to read without squinting.

🎨 UI / UX

  • Text Scale defaults to 150%. New installs and players still on the old 100% default are bumped to 150% once. The slider now runs up to **200%** for those who want even larger in-game text.

  • Title, dream, and offline screens fixed at 150%. These overlays no longer follow the Text Scale slider — they always render at a comfortable 150% baseline so narrative moments stay readable.

  • Dream screen readability pass. Larger narrative and choice description text, brighter contrast on offline duration and effect hints, and body copy switched from italic dim text to normal weight on primary/secondary colors.
